Hi. New member from SF, CA and I've been lurking for a couple month's now. Finally in the market for some new clubs.

I have a question about shaft fittings if someone can work through the following with me:

I'm 49 and 5/6th's yrs old, started golfing when I was 22. Just started playing again regularly after playing 2-4 rounds a year for the last four or five yrs. About three months ago my wife asked me if I want to go to Bandon Dunes for my 50th in March. I said yes and have been playing at least once a week since. Now in the market for some new irons.

My three sets since I started playing are some KMart Dunlops, Lynx Parallax (prob 1" too long, at least) and the Titleist 735 DCM's I've been playing for 13-14 yrs. The DCM's were bought at Golf Mart, just walked in, looked at the used demo's for sale, hit some, liked the DCM's and that was it.

I did my first fitting ever on Sat and was really hoping I'd fit into the Hogan PTX Pro/Apex combo or the Srixon ZX combo, especially after living in those threads on THP for a couple weeks now. Was especially hoping the Hogan's would be a good fit because value (less $) and I like the looks.

Srixon and Hogan just weren't working at the fitting and long story short is the fitter ended up putting me in a Project X LZ 6.0 with the Apex '21. I kept pushing everything right of centerline on straight flight paths. The fitter did ask for a draw and I was able to put very playable shots on the ball when thinking about a draw at address. I was getting about 10-15 yards extra carry over the 735's 6 iron but I striped the 735 with my typical ball flight, slight draw, and the grouping was tightest of everything I hit. So, I wasn't stoked on the Apex. I was like, yeah, I guess I could get these and end up working with them. In the hitting bay at the fitting I was thinking maybe I'll just rehaft my 735's.

I then asked if I could hit the Apex Pro's which I felt were a little aspirational for me playing to a 14 hc. From the get go, w/the PX LZ 6.0's, I was dead centerline with a slight draw. They FELT so much better, they sounded better (made me realize how clicky the Apex sounded), and the extra weight at address felt really nice to me. My mindset went from, I can make these work for me, I guess (w/the Apex), to I can play with these right now, AND they're more forgiving than my 735's. The Apex Pro grouping was tighter than the Apex group, they sounded and felt way better, like smile on my face better, and I only lost two yards on average versus the Apex. So, sold.

My question is about the shaft and swing weight. The Apex clubhead is the one we used through shaft fitting, loft and lie settings, etc. The Apex Pro trial was kind of a what the hell, why not try it before I head out the door deal...Struck it better than the Apex, loved the way it looked at address and the way it sounded and felt while striking it. From there we didn't revisit the shaft or lie angle. So my question is, is that how it works? ...does it make sense that the shaft that was dialed in with the Apex would be my ideal shaft in the Apex Pro? Also, the swing weight is D7. Seems heavy looking at it on paper. I have no idea what the swing weight on my 735s is but they are DG300s shafts which are heavier from what I gather. Is D7 a kook heavy swing weight?

Welcome to THP!

regarding your question, it all comes down to fit for the player. So I am not surprised at all a shaft that was okay in one head ends up working better in another. Clubs aren’t made to do the same thing so the spin and launch profile of the shaft matched up better with the Pro for your swing. You found what worked and are going with it. I wouldn’t question it from there.

Regarding swing weight, that does sound a little heavy but again, if it’s working how you want it to, it’s just a number. I mean I don’t even know what the swing weight of my irons are. I just know they feel good and I hit them well lol

Welcome. I used to build clubs (custom). Are the proposed irons also an inch long? That could be the SW thing and if so have you considered a lighter shaft? I would be more concerned with total weight personally and not so with SW if feels good when swinging. I was recently fitted one inch long (PXG on a Vereran discount) but with Accra graphite and are about D1. Sounds like you have a pretty fast swing so in the end rely on fitting and performance. Like @Muchmore18 said, I wouldn't worry too much about the shaft/head combo if you were happy with what you saw (flight, spin, dispersion etc.). Sounds like you found something that could work. And really, the Pro's aren't too far off from your 735's - like you said, probably a little more forgiving!

Swing weight does sound a little heavy at D7, but again, if you're happy with the results I'd just go with it. If I remember, the stated swing weight of those off the rack was around D2 when paired with the stock shaft.
